Home Health: Care That Never Sleeps (24 hour care) Telehealth (24 hour monitoring by a RN) Great Steps (sm) (better balance vestibular fall prevention program) On Your Feet in 3 (intense therapy program for hip and knee Replacement, post-op management) Modalities: E-Stim therapy, Ultrasound therapy, Infrared therapy, Anodyne therapy Vital Stim (dysphagia therapy) Roll-To-Control (urinary continence) Homesight (low vision program) SCD (compression)/deep vein Thrombosis care LSVT Big and Loud (researched-based improvements in patients with Parkinson Disease) Hospice: Care That Never Sleeps Music Therapy (provided by board-certified music therapists) Massage Therapy (provided by licensed massage therapists) Life Stories Legacy Program (allows patient to review life history) Hospice For Veterans (partner with We Honor Veterans, a program created with the US Department of Veterans Affairs, attends to unique needs of veterans at end of life) Tasteful Solutions (easy to implement, person-centered nutrition Supplement program)
